In pasture, on a NW-facing slope. A circular area (38m NE-SW) defined by an earthen bank (Wth 8.3m; int. H 1.1m; ext. H 1.6m) N-W. The bank has been levelled W-N where the ground slopes gently down from the interior to the surrounding field. An external fosse (Wth c. 2.4m; D 0.6m) is evident SW-W but is covered by overgrowth. The interior slopes down to the NNW. There is a circular depression (diam. 2m; D 0.4m) in the NW quadrant of the interior. Field boundaries radiate from the N, SSW and W arcs of the rath.
